IB Chemistry
(1 CREDIT) PHYSICAL SCIENCE
Prerequisite: 11/12th grade, 80% on Algebra Regents, successful completion of 2 high school science classes, enrollment in a previous chemistry class recommended and current enrollment in (or past completion of) Geometry.
This IB course will be an extension of our current Regents Chemistry course. Topics include: Stoichiometric relationships, Atomic structure, Periodicity, Chemical bonding and structure, Energetics/thermochemistry, Chemical kinetics, Equilibrium, Acids and bases, Redox processes, Organic chemistry, Measurement and data processing. A lab class that meets separately from the regular class is a required component of the course. Students will be prepared for the Regents Chemistry exam, and the IB Standard Level exam that is administered in May, which fulfills the IB science requirement for the IB Diploma.
